    Let \(E_n(g)\) be the \(n\)th energy eigenvalue of the anharmonic oscillator whose Schrödinger equation is NEWLINE\[NEWLINE \Bigl(-\frac 12 \frac{d^2}{dx^2}+\frac{x^2}2+gx^4-E_n(g) \Bigr)\psi(x)=0. NEWLINE\]NEWLINE The function \(E_n(g)\) is expressible by an asymptotic power series in \(g\) and satisfies the once-subtracted dispersion relation NEWLINE\[NEWLINE E_n(g)=E^{(0)}_n+\frac{(-g)}{2\pi i}\int^{\infty}_0 \frac{\Delta E_n(z)}{z(z+g)} dz, \quad E^{(0)}_n=n+1/2, NEWLINE\]NEWLINE where \(\Delta E_n(z)\equiv E_n( e^{-i\pi}z)-E_n(e^{+i\pi}z)\) is the discontinuity of \(E_n(g)\) across the negative \(g\) axis when \(g=-z.\) Here, using this relation, the authors obtain a second-level hyperasymptotic expansion of \(E_n(g).\) Furthermore, errors for truncated partial sums are evaluated.NEWLINENEWLINEFor the entire collection see [Zbl 0969.00055].
